反应信息

  • 作为反应物:
    描述:
    methyl 2-(4-bromonaphthalen-1-yl)acetate 在 lithium hydroxide 、 正丁基锂硫酸二异丙胺 作用下, 以 四氢呋喃甲醇正己烷 为溶剂, 反应 22.33h, 生成 5-methyl-3-(4-bromo-1-naphthyl)tetrahydrofuran-2-one
    参考文献:
    名称:
    Synthesis and structure–antifungal activity Relationships of 3-Aryl-5-alkyl-2,5-dihydrofuran-2-ones and Their Carbanalogues: further refinement of tentative pharmacophore group
    摘要:
    Two series of 3-(substituted phenyl)-5-alkyl-2,5-dihydrofuran-2-ones related to a natural product, (-)incrustoporine, were synthesized and their in vitro antifungal activity evaluated. The compounds with halogen substituents on the phenyl ring exhibited selective antifungal activity against the filamentous strains of Absidia corymbifera and Aspergillus fumigatus. On the other hand, the influence of the lenghth of the alkyl chain at C(5) was marginal. The antifungal effect of the most active compound against the above strains was higher than that of ketoconazole, and close to that of amphotericin B. In order to verify the hypothesis about a possible relationship between the Michael-accepting ability of the compounds and their antifungal activity, a series of simple carbanalogues, 2-(substituted phenyl)cyclopent-2-enones, was prepared and subjected to antifungal activity assay as well. (C) 2003 Elsevier Science Ltd. All rights reserved.
    DOI:
    10.1016/s0968-0896(03)00220-7

  • Enantioselective α-Allylation of Acyclic Esters Using B(pin)-Substituted Electrophiles: Independent Regulation of Stereocontrol Elements through Cooperative Pd/Lewis Base Catalysis
    作者:W. Rush Scaggs、Thomas N. Snaddon
    DOI:10.1002/chem.201803543
    日期:2018.9.25
    Cooperation between a Lewis base and Pd catalyst enables the direct enantioselective α‐functionalization of aryl and vinyl acetic acid esters using a bifunctional B(pin)‐substituted electrophile. Critical to the success of this method was the recognition that both catalysts could control the necessary stereochemical aspects; the Lewis base catalyst controls the enantioselectivity of the reaction, whereas
    Lewis碱和Pd催化剂之间的配合可使用双官能团B(pin)取代的亲电试剂对芳基和乙烯基乙酸酯进行直接对映选择性α-官能化。认识到两种催化剂都可以控制必要的立体化学方面,是该方法成功的关键。Lewis碱催化剂控制反应的对映选择性,而Pd催化剂调节烯基-B(pin)构型。这是在Pd催化的烯丙基烷基化过程中使用协同催化控制两个立体化学特征的第一个例子。
